堆排序算法課程設(shè)計(jì)報(bào)告_第1頁(yè)
堆排序算法課程設(shè)計(jì)報(bào)告_第2頁(yè)
堆排序算法課程設(shè)計(jì)報(bào)告_第3頁(yè)
堆排序算法課程設(shè)計(jì)報(bào)告_第4頁(yè)
堆排序算法課程設(shè)計(jì)報(bào)告_第5頁(yè)
已閱讀5頁(yè),還剩1頁(yè)未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

堆排序算法課程設(shè)計(jì)報(bào)告一、課程目標(biāo)

知識(shí)目標(biāo):

1.學(xué)生能理解堆排序算法的基本概念與原理,掌握堆的定義、性質(zhì)以及如何構(gòu)建和調(diào)整堆。

2.學(xué)生能掌握堆排序算法的步驟,并能夠運(yùn)用其解決實(shí)際問題。

3.學(xué)生了解堆排序算法的時(shí)間復(fù)雜度和空間復(fù)雜度,并能夠與其他排序算法進(jìn)行比較。

技能目標(biāo):

1.學(xué)生通過堆排序算法的學(xué)習(xí),培養(yǎng)其邏輯思維能力和問題解決能力。

2.學(xué)生能夠運(yùn)用編程語(yǔ)言實(shí)現(xiàn)堆排序算法,提高其編程實(shí)踐能力。

3.學(xué)生通過動(dòng)手實(shí)踐,學(xué)會(huì)分析算法性能,提高其算法優(yōu)化能力。

情感態(tài)度價(jià)值觀目標(biāo):

1.學(xué)生在探究堆排序算法的過程中,培養(yǎng)其團(tuán)隊(duì)合作意識(shí)和積極的學(xué)習(xí)態(tài)度。

2.學(xué)生通過堆排序算法的學(xué)習(xí),增強(qiáng)對(duì)計(jì)算機(jī)科學(xué)領(lǐng)域的興趣和熱情。

3.學(xué)生在學(xué)習(xí)過程中,樹立正確的價(jià)值觀,認(rèn)識(shí)到算法在解決實(shí)際問題中的重要作用。

課程性質(zhì):本課程為計(jì)算機(jī)科學(xué)領(lǐng)域的一門實(shí)踐性課程,旨在幫助學(xué)生掌握堆排序算法的基本原理和應(yīng)用。

學(xué)生特點(diǎn):本課程面向高中年級(jí)學(xué)生,學(xué)生已經(jīng)具備了一定的編程基礎(chǔ)和邏輯思維能力,對(duì)排序算法有一定的了解。

教學(xué)要求:教師應(yīng)結(jié)合學(xué)生特點(diǎn),采用啟發(fā)式教學(xué)方法,引導(dǎo)學(xué)生自主探究堆排序算法,注重培養(yǎng)學(xué)生的實(shí)踐能力和團(tuán)隊(duì)合作精神。在教學(xué)過程中,關(guān)注學(xué)生的個(gè)體差異,鼓勵(lì)學(xué)生積極參與討論和分享,確保課程目標(biāo)的實(shí)現(xiàn)。通過課后實(shí)踐作業(yè)和課堂評(píng)估,檢驗(yàn)學(xué)生的學(xué)習(xí)成果。

二、教學(xué)內(nèi)容

本課程教學(xué)內(nèi)容主要包括以下幾部分:

1.堆的基本概念與性質(zhì):介紹堆的定義、類型(大頂堆、小頂堆),闡述堆的性質(zhì)以及堆與完全二叉樹的關(guān)系。

教材章節(jié):第三章第二節(jié)

2.堆的構(gòu)建與調(diào)整:講解如何通過向上調(diào)整和向下調(diào)整方法構(gòu)建和維持堆的性質(zhì)。

教材章節(jié):第三章第三節(jié)

3.堆排序算法步驟:詳細(xì)講解堆排序的整個(gè)過程,包括建堆、排序等步驟。

教材章節(jié):第三章第四節(jié)

4.堆排序算法的實(shí)現(xiàn):指導(dǎo)學(xué)生使用編程語(yǔ)言(如C/C++、Java等)實(shí)現(xiàn)堆排序算法。

教材章節(jié):第三章第五節(jié)

5.算法性能分析:分析堆排序算法的時(shí)間復(fù)雜度和空間復(fù)雜度,與其他排序算法進(jìn)行比較。

教材章節(jié):第三章第六節(jié)

教學(xué)內(nèi)容安排與進(jìn)度:

第一課時(shí):堆的基本概念與性質(zhì)

第二課時(shí):堆的構(gòu)建與調(diào)整

第三課時(shí):堆排序算法步驟

第四課時(shí):堆排序算法的實(shí)現(xiàn)(上機(jī)實(shí)踐)

第五課時(shí):算法性能分析及優(yōu)化

教學(xué)內(nèi)容注重科學(xué)性和系統(tǒng)性,結(jié)合教材章節(jié)和課程目標(biāo),合理安排教學(xué)進(jìn)度,確保學(xué)生能夠逐步掌握堆排序算法的相關(guān)知識(shí)。同時(shí),通過上機(jī)實(shí)踐,提高學(xué)生的實(shí)際操作能力。

三、教學(xué)方法

本課程采用以下多樣化的教學(xué)方法,以激發(fā)學(xué)生的學(xué)習(xí)興趣和主動(dòng)性:

1.講授法:在講解堆的基本概念、性質(zhì)及堆排序算法步驟等理論部分,采用講授法進(jìn)行教學(xué)。教師通過生動(dòng)的語(yǔ)言、形象的比喻和具體的案例,使學(xué)生易于理解和掌握堆排序的相關(guān)知識(shí)。

關(guān)聯(lián)教材內(nèi)容:第三章第一節(jié)、第二節(jié)、第四節(jié)

2.討論法:在堆的構(gòu)建與調(diào)整、算法性能分析等環(huán)節(jié),組織學(xué)生進(jìn)行小組討論。鼓勵(lì)學(xué)生提出問題、分析問題、解決問題,培養(yǎng)其邏輯思維和團(tuán)隊(duì)協(xié)作能力。

關(guān)聯(lián)教材內(nèi)容:第三章第三節(jié)、第六節(jié)

3.案例分析法:通過分析具體案例,讓學(xué)生了解堆排序算法在實(shí)際問題中的應(yīng)用,培養(yǎng)學(xué)生的實(shí)際應(yīng)用能力。

關(guān)聯(lián)教材內(nèi)容:第三章第五節(jié)

4.實(shí)驗(yàn)法:安排上機(jī)實(shí)踐課程,讓學(xué)生動(dòng)手實(shí)現(xiàn)堆排序算法,培養(yǎng)其編程實(shí)踐能力和算法應(yīng)用能力。

關(guān)聯(lián)教材內(nèi)容:第三章第五節(jié)、第六節(jié)

具體教學(xué)方法實(shí)施如下:

1.講授法:教師結(jié)合教材內(nèi)容,利用多媒體教學(xué)手段,進(jìn)行生動(dòng)、形象的講解,引導(dǎo)學(xué)生掌握堆排序算法的基本概念和步驟。

2.討論法:將學(xué)生分為若干小組,針對(duì)堆的構(gòu)建與調(diào)整、算法性能分析等問題進(jìn)行討論。教師巡回指導(dǎo),解答學(xué)生疑問,促進(jìn)學(xué)生之間的交流與合作。

3.案例分析法:挑選具有代表性的案例,讓學(xué)生分析堆排序算法在案例中的應(yīng)用。教師引導(dǎo)學(xué)生總結(jié)案例中的關(guān)鍵問題和解決方法,提高學(xué)生的分析能力。

4.實(shí)驗(yàn)法:教師布置上機(jī)實(shí)踐任務(wù),要求學(xué)生獨(dú)立完成堆排序算法的實(shí)現(xiàn)。在實(shí)踐中,教師巡回指導(dǎo),幫助學(xué)生解決編程中遇到的問題,提高學(xué)生的編程實(shí)踐能力。

四、教學(xué)評(píng)估

為確保教學(xué)效果,全面反映學(xué)生的學(xué)習(xí)成果,本課程采用以下評(píng)估方式:

1.平時(shí)表現(xiàn):關(guān)注學(xué)生在課堂上的參與程度、提問回答、討論表現(xiàn)等,評(píng)估學(xué)生的學(xué)習(xí)態(tài)度和積極性。

關(guān)聯(lián)教材內(nèi)容:第三章全章

2.作業(yè):布置與堆排序算法相關(guān)的理論作業(yè)和實(shí)踐作業(yè),檢驗(yàn)學(xué)生對(duì)課堂所學(xué)知識(shí)的掌握程度。

關(guān)聯(lián)教材內(nèi)容:第三章第三節(jié)、第五節(jié)

3.考試:組織期中和期末考試,全面評(píng)估學(xué)生對(duì)堆排序算法理論知識(shí)和實(shí)踐能力的掌握。

關(guān)聯(lián)教材內(nèi)容:第三章全章

具體評(píng)估方式如下:

1.平時(shí)表現(xiàn)(占總評(píng)20%):教師記錄學(xué)生在課堂上的表現(xiàn),包括出勤、提問、討論等。評(píng)估標(biāo)準(zhǔn)包括學(xué)習(xí)態(tài)度、團(tuán)隊(duì)合作和積極參與程度。

2.作業(yè)(占總評(píng)30%):理論作業(yè)主要包括課后習(xí)題、算法分析等,實(shí)踐作業(yè)為上機(jī)實(shí)現(xiàn)堆排序算法。作業(yè)評(píng)分關(guān)注學(xué)生的完成質(zhì)量、編程規(guī)范和創(chuàng)新能力。

-理論作業(yè):第三章相關(guān)習(xí)題

-實(shí)踐作業(yè):實(shí)現(xiàn)堆排序算法,分析算法性能

3.考試(占總評(píng)50%):期中和期末考試分別評(píng)估學(xué)生對(duì)堆排序算法理論知識(shí)的掌握和實(shí)踐能力。考試形式包括選擇題、填空題、簡(jiǎn)答題和上機(jī)操作題。

-期中考試:第三章前四節(jié)內(nèi)容

-期末考試:第三章全章內(nèi)容,重點(diǎn)關(guān)注堆排序算法的實(shí)現(xiàn)和性能分析

教學(xué)評(píng)估注重客觀、公正,關(guān)注學(xué)生的個(gè)體差異。通過多樣化的評(píng)估方式,全面反映學(xué)生的學(xué)習(xí)成果,激發(fā)學(xué)生的學(xué)習(xí)興趣和動(dòng)力。同時(shí),教師根據(jù)評(píng)估結(jié)果調(diào)整教學(xué)策略,以提高教學(xué)質(zhì)量和學(xué)生的學(xué)習(xí)效果。

五、教學(xué)安排

為確保教學(xué)進(jìn)度和效果,本課程的教學(xué)安排如下:

1.教學(xué)進(jìn)度:根據(jù)教學(xué)內(nèi)容和學(xué)生的實(shí)際情況,將教學(xué)進(jìn)度劃分為五個(gè)階段,每個(gè)階段包含一個(gè)課時(shí)。

-第一階段:堆的基本概念與性質(zhì)(1課時(shí))

-第二階段:堆的構(gòu)建與調(diào)整(1課時(shí))

-第三階段:堆排序算法步驟(1課時(shí))

-第四階段:堆排序算法的實(shí)現(xiàn)(1課時(shí),上機(jī)實(shí)踐)

-第五階段:算法性能分析及優(yōu)化(1課時(shí))

2.教學(xué)時(shí)間:每周安排一次課程,每次課程時(shí)長(zhǎng)為45分鐘。上機(jī)實(shí)踐課程安排在理論課程之后,時(shí)長(zhǎng)為1小時(shí)。

-理論課程:周一至周五,上午8:00-8:45

-上機(jī)實(shí)踐:周一至周五,上午9:00-10:00

3.教學(xué)地點(diǎn):理論課程在教室進(jìn)行,上機(jī)實(shí)踐在計(jì)算機(jī)實(shí)驗(yàn)室進(jìn)行。

教學(xué)安排考慮因素:

1.學(xué)生作息時(shí)間:根據(jù)學(xué)生的日常作息時(shí)間,將課程安排在上午,確保學(xué)生精力充沛地進(jìn)行學(xué)習(xí)。

2.學(xué)生興趣愛好:在上機(jī)實(shí)踐環(huán)節(jié),允許學(xué)生自主選擇編程語(yǔ)言和工具,以激發(fā)學(xué)生的學(xué)習(xí)興趣和積極性。

3.學(xué)生實(shí)際情況:考慮到學(xué)生可能存在的個(gè)體差異,教師將在課堂上關(guān)注學(xué)生的

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論